RetroSound ® Now Shipping New Quad4 Power Amplifier

Retro Manufacturing, a leading manufacturer of audio products for the classic vehicle market, has announced they are now shipping their new RetroSound® Quad4 power amplifier.  The Quad4 is a four-channel amplifier featuring Class D digital circuitry, with power output rated at 45 watts x 4 channels RMS.  For ease of installation, the Quad4 offers direct connection to any RetroSound® radio.  It can also be connected to any after-market car stereo system with the included RCA low-level inputs.

The Quad4 has a miniscule footprint, measuring just 7 x 3 x 1 ¾ inches; it can easily be mounted almost anywhere — including behind the dash.  It features advanced protection circuitry and a built-in high-pass/full-range crossover, and offers exceptional dynamic range and low distortion for the best possible sound when used in any audio system.  The Quad4 has a suggested retail price of $199.95.
